The Biden admin just handed out its first federal grant to dismantle a highway built to perpetuate racial discrimination. (via thereidout Blog)

and transportation innovation, by handing out its first federal grant to dismantle a highway built to perpetuate racial discrimination.

The move is part of the Biden administration’s broader effort to remake America’s infrastructure to be more equitable, including addressing racist roads that were designed to facilitate white flight and deprive Black communities of housing and commercial opportunities.on Thursday that $104.

“With these funds, we’re now partnering with the state and the community to transform it into a road that will connect rather than divide,” he added.Detroit’s project would create a slower-speed boulevard that aims to improve safety by removing a steep curve and adding LED lighting, while removing 15 old bridges and two stormwater runoff pump stations and building out wider sidewalks, protected bike lanes and pedestrian crossings.

In his role as head of the Transportation Department, Buttigieg has spoken directly of America’s racist infrastructure, and he’s placed a particular emphasis on road construction. And after Republicans threw public tantrums over his acknowledgment of racism built into American infrastructure, Buttigieg was taken aback., “I don’t think we have anything to lose by confronting that reality.

Thursday’s announcement included millions of dollars more for separate projects in Arizona, Colorado, New York and states across the country. The significant amount needed to resurrect Black Bottom and its surrounding areas shows how devastating America’s racist infrastructure has been. And it’s a sign a lot more money will be needed to correct the problem nationwide.
